Located in Pinellas County, Florida, St. Pete Beach is a community with a population of 8,832. At $108,931, its median household income sits above Pinellas County's $70,293.

Between 2019 and 2023, St. Pete Beach's population declined 7.9% from 9,587 to 8,832, while its median home value rose 38.4% from $462,500 to $639,900.

7.6% of residents live below the poverty line. Households average 1.83 people.
